Ingredients You’ll Need

Gathering the right ingredients is a big part of the magic behind these cookies. Each one is simple but essential, carefully chosen to build the perfect combination of flavor, texture, and color that makes the Strawberry Crunch Cookies – A Sweet and Crunchy Delight Recipe so memorable.

  • 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our: The backbone of your cookie, creating structure and tenderness.
  • 1/2 cup sugar: Adds just the right amount of sweetness to make every bite delightful.
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, softened: Brings richness and helps achieve that melt-in-your-mouth texture.
  • 1 egg: Acts as a binding agent, keeping everything perfectly together.
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ract: Elevates flavors with its warm, aromatic goodness.
  • 1/2 tsp baking powder: Helps give the cookies a gentle rise and light crumb.
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da: Works with baking powder to ensure your cookies aren’t dense.
  • 1/4 cup freeze-dried strawberries, crushed: Bursts of sweet, fruity flavor with a little natural tang and vivid pink flecks.
  • 1/4 cup crushed graham crackers: Adds a delightful crunch and a subtle hint of honey and cinnamon.

How to Make Strawberry Crunch Cookies – A Sweet and Crunchy Delight Recipe

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

Start by heating your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per – this helps prevent sticking and encourages even baking. Getting this step right means your cookies will bake perfectly every single time.

Step 2: Cream Butter and Sugar

In a large bowl, use a mixer or a sturdy spoon to cream together your softened butter and sugar until the mixture becomes light in color and fluffy in texture. This process is key because it incorporates air, ensuring tender and soft cookies.

Step 3: Add Wet Ingredients

Beat in the egg along with the vanilla extract. These ingredients add moisture and a touch of aromatic sweetness that enhances the overall cookie flavor. Make sure everything is well combined before moving on.

Step 4: Mix Dry Ingredients

In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and baking soda. This ensures your leavening agents are evenly distributed. Gradually add this dry mixture to your wet ingredients, stirring gently until everything is just combined. Avoid over-mixing to keep the cookies tender.

Step 5: Add Crunch and Flavor

Now for the fun part! Stir in the crushed freeze-dried strawberries and graham crackers. Their contrasting textures and flavors are what truly make the Strawberry Crunch Cookies – A Sweet and Crunchy Delight Recipe stand out. The strawberries add bursts of fruity sweetness, while the graham crackers bring an irresistible crispness.

Step 6: Shape the Cookies

Drop spoonfuls of dough onto your pr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art. This spacing allows the cookies to spread without merging into one another, giving you those picture-perfect rounds.

Step 7: Bake

Bake for 8-10 minutes until the edges turn a beautiful golden brown. Keep an eye on them – those golden edges mean the cookies are cooked through but still soft inside, achieving the perfect chewy yet crunchy balance.

Step 8: Cool

Let your cookies c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es – this helps them set without breaking apart. Trans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ely before enjoying. Cooling is essential to reaching that wonderful crunchiness.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Keep your leftover Strawberry Crunch C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days to maintain their freshness and crunch. Avoid stacking too many on top of each other to prevent them from getting soggy.

Freezing

If you want to enjoy these cookies days later, freeze them in a single layer on a baking sheet,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ag or container. They can be stored frozen for up to 2 months without losing their flavor or texture.

Reheating

To revive that signature crunch, warm your cookies in a preheated oven at 300°F (150°C) for about 5 minutes. This gentle heat refreshes their texture and reawakens the aromas – just like freshly baked!

FAQs

Can I substitute fresh strawberries for freeze-dried in the Strawberry Crunch Cookies – A Sweet and Crunchy Delight Recipe?

While fresh strawberries add moisture that can change the cookie’s texture, using freeze-dried strawberries keeps the cookies crisp and flavorful. If you use fresh strawberries, the dough will be wetter and the cookies might spread more and lose crunch.

Are these cookies suitable for kids?

Absolutely! These cookies are a hit with kids due to their sweet, fruity flavor and satisfying crunch. Plus, they contain simple, wholesome ingredients that you can feel good about serving.

Can I make the dough ahead of time?

Yes! You can prepare the dough and refrigerate it for up to 24 hours before baking. Just make sure to cover it well. Chilling the dough can actually enhance the flavors and improve the cookie texture.

What if I don’t have graham crackers for the crunch?

If you don’t have graham crackers, crushed digestive biscuits or vanilla wafers make great substitutes. They will provide a similar crunchy texture and a slight sweetness to complement the strawberries.

How do I avoid cookies spreading too much in the oven?

Make sure your butter is softened but not melted and avoid over-mixing the dough. Also, chilling the dough before baking can help the cookies hold their shape better and maintain that perfect balance of softness and crunch.
